What type of cable is used for satellite TV?

What type of cable is used for satellite TV?

Coaxial cable is perfect for broadcast television and satellite signals, which carry a huge amount of information and are very sensitive to outside interference. A satellite signal cable must carry signals from 2MHz to 3,000MHz. Compare that with an audio cable which just needs to carry signals up to 2 MHz.

What is the best coaxial cable for satellite TV?

Coaxial cable designed for domestic television should be 75 Ohm, with RG-6 coaxial being ideal for TV. The best coaxial cable for HDTV is RG-11. This type of cable offers a higher gauge than others, which provides more space for signals to transfer.

Is TV coaxial cable the same as satellite cable?

Yes. Satellite TV and aerials use the same coaxial cable. You can use a satellite cable with a TV aerial but you may need to change the connector to an F-Type that’s compatible with TVs, top boxes, and other devices.

What is a TV coaxial cable?

A coaxial cable carries the signal from a satellite, antenna, or cable line to a TV. A coaxial cable is a copper conductor wire surrounded by layers of insulation that protect the line from being disrupted by surrounding radio frequencies and electromagnetic interference.

What is the maximum length for coaxial cable?

Coaxial cable can be cabled over longer distances than twisted-pair cable. For example, Ethernet can run approximately 100 meters (328 feet) using twisted-pair cabling. Using coaxial cable increases this distance to 500m (1640.4 feet).

What coax cable should be used for cable television?

The most common coaxial cable used for home television setups is RG6. That being said, you could also go with RG11 coaxial cables, however they tend to be more expensive compared to RG6. The only real difference between the two is the distance the cable can carry a signal without a degradation in the transmission.

What is coaxial cable and how is it used?

Coaxial cable, sometimes known as coax cable, is an electrical cable which transmits radio frequency (RF) signals from one point to another. The technology has been around since the early 20th century, with these cables mainly being used to connect satellite antenna facilities to homes and businesses thanks to their durability and ease of installation.
